Job: Senior Design Engineer
To work as part of the Design Engineering Team; interpreting customer specifications to configure existing products or create new product designs, creating models and drawings using 3D CAD, creating Bills of Material and documentation to support business functions. Overseeing engineering design tasks related to customer enquiries to ensure delivery of work packages to the required quality, delivery and cost.
Duties:-
•Interpret customer requirements / specifications and translate into engineered product design, aligning with both technical & commercial requirements.
oEnsure tasks are planned & prioritised to support on-time delivery to project requirements.
oProduce detailed designs for new products using 3D CAD.
•Produce 3D Models, Engineering Drawings, and BOMs to allow manufacture of components.
•Solve mechanical Engineering problems and be able to demonstrate a clear and logical methodology.
•Perform & document Engineering calculations to allow colleagues and third-parties to interpret and validate the results.
•Perform FEA analysis where necessary to assess and document suitability of new designs / design modifications.
•Analyse & document test data to verify compliance to specification requirements.
•Compile professional engineering documents for distribution internally and to the customer, discussing and presenting report findings when necessary.
•To ensure designs are accurate and conform to required design codes (API, ISO, PED, ASME VIII) and customer specifications.
•Utilise DFM / DFA methodologies in all design work.
•Participate in Continuous Improvement initiatives, including problem-solving to enhance existing products and processes.
•Checking of Drawings and B.O.M.’s.
•Support the transition of new products into Production.
•Input into Engineering strategy, policies & procedures to drive company direction.
•Act as a mentor to other Engineers within the business.
•Support the Engineering department at a variety of meetings both internally and occasionally at Customer sites, providing Engineering support and advice as appropriate.
•Deputise for the Principal Engineer when required.
•Other Engineering tasks as delegated by the Product Design Manager.
•Business Travel will be required from time to time.
Knowledge, Skills and training: -
•A recognised qualification in Mechanical Engineering.
•Experienced user of 3D CAD for design and drafting.
•Conceptual & detailed design skills.
•Design for Manufacture & Assembly.
•Experience of designing high pressure equipment to industry standards.
•Ability to produce detailed design calculations and reports.
•Experienced in the use of Finite Element Analysis.
•An understanding of materials and their applications, metals in particular.
•Familiarity in the use of Geometrical Design and Tolerancing (GD&T).
•To have a pro-active attitude and be able to demonstrate good analytical and problem-solving skills.
•Knowledge of using an MRP System (e.g. Visual, Syteline) to produce BOM’s.
•Experience of using a Quality management system database.
•Work to and promote high standards of quality, with a strong focus on safety.
•Knowledge of technical software such as MathCAD and LabView.
•A positive approach with good interpersonal skills, and the ability to work independently or as part of a team.
•The ability to plan your own activities within a project and be adaptable to changing priorities and demanding deadlines.
•Proficient in the use of MS Office Products, particularly Excel.
